Smuts are small particles of soot, ash or dirt that can soil or stain surfaces. Synonyms for smuts include grime, soot, dirt, dust, grease, and filth, among others. These words refer to substances or materials that make surfaces, fabrics and other materials appear dirty or unclean. They can be caused by pollution, industrial processes, or simply by everyday use and wear. It's important to clean and remove smuts regularly to maintain a healthy and hygienic environment. While many different words can be used to describe smuts, the basic idea is the same: they are unwanted particles that detract from the appearance and cleanliness of objects and spaces.
